Police on Saturday morning arrested 22-year-old Anthony Maurice Jackson and a juvenile in connection with a Hixson robbery in which shots were fired.
Jesse Avery and Roy Roberson told police the robbery happened at 834 Monroe Road. They said they were planning to buy drugs and had called a man Roberson knew as "Hey Man".
Roberson and two black males picked up Avery at a BP station on Hixson Pike and began driving around. The driver stopped the silver Ford Focus at the Monroe Road address, pulled out a handgun and told Roberson to empty his pockets.
When Roberson handed over his wallet and cellphone, the driver fired a shot toward Roberson. The front-seat passenger then produced a handgun and told Avery to get out of the car. Avery also handed over his wallet and cellphone and began running toward Hixson Pike. A shot was fired at him that struck a nearby cleaners at the corner of Hixson Pike and Monroe.
The suspects then left in the Focus.
Roberson told police that the driver lived at 4518 Hixson Pike. Police found Jackson and the juvenile inside an apartment there. Inside the unit, officers found two handguns and also found the stolen cellphones. The batteries had been removed and the sim cars were immersed in a glass of water in an effort to destroy them.
Police said the juvenile gave a statement about the incident.
Charges included two counts of aggravated robbery, two counts of aggravated assault and possesion of a handgun.
